Abstract
Innovative methodologies will be developed to combine satellite data, in-situ measurements, atmospheric forcings and diagnostic models in synergy, and produce new environmental data over the North Atlantic Ocean, specifically filling the present observational gaps of ocean currents in the upper layers. New data will also serve to better respond to research needs aiming to include ecosystem considerations in the provision of scientific advice to fishery management in the area.
Goals
We will develop a daily (sub)mesoscale product of 3D ocean currents (u,v,w), at mesoscale-resolving spatial resolution (1/10°x1/10°), over a wide section of the central/North Atlantic Ocean (NATL3D). NATL3D product will cover a minimum of ten years (2010-2019) and will be based on a combination of satellite data, in-situ measurements, atmospheric forcings and diagnostic models in synergy.
Knowledge of full 3D currents down to depths below the deepest mixed layer will then allow the exploration of the potential impact of long term oceanic variability on the population dynamics of different fish species. This includes the investigation of the role of frontal meanders and eddies in the transport and dispersal of eels' larvae, of the vertical exchanges at the base of the euphotic layer and their potential impact on primary productivity
